Sheng, pronounced shēng, is a traditional Chinese reed instrument with a profound historical and cultural background. The discussion is as follows:

1. Sheng was widely used in various music performances in ancient times, including folk music, court music, religious music, etc. It is an instrument with unique timbre and expressive power. Its timbre is melodious, crisp and pleasant, and can express different emotions and atmospheres.

2. The structure of the sheng is relatively unique, consisting of a sheng bucket, a reed, a pipe and other parts. The pipe is the main part of the Sheng, the reed is the sound-producing part of the Sheng, and the tube is the sound hole of the Sheng. The reeds of the Sheng are usually made of bamboo or brass. When the reeds vibrate, they produce sound. Through the sound of the Sheng bucket and the pipe, the Sheng's unique timbre is formed.

3. Sheng plays an important role in the history of Chinese music. It is one of the traditional Chinese wind instruments with a long history and rich cultural connotation. In ancient times, the Sheng was widely used in various occasions, including sacrifices, banquets, weddings and funerals, etc. In different occasions, the role played by Sheng is also different. Sometimes it is an accompaniment instrument, sometimes it is a solo instrument.

The evolution of the character Sheng is as follows:

1. The evolution of the character Sheng can be traced back to ancient oracle bone inscriptions and bronze inscriptions. In early oracle bone inscriptions and bronze inscriptions, the character Sheng is depicted as two rows of bamboo tubes juxtaposed, which is the basic structure of the Sheng. With the passage of time, the Sheng character gradually developed into the current regular script, official script, running script and other different writing forms.
